SQL in 複数の効率的なデータ操作方法一覧

私たちはデータベースの世界において、SQLがどれほど重要な役割を果たしているかを知っています。特にSQL in 複数は、複数のデータを扱う際に欠かせない技術です。このトピックについて深く掘り下げていくことで、皆さんがどのように効率的にデータを操作できるかを理解できるでしょう。

SQL In 複数の基本

SQLは、データベースの操作において非常に重要な役割を果たします。特に複数のデータを効率的に管理するために不可欠な技術です。これから、SQLと複数について詳しく見ていきます。

SQLとは

SQL(Structured Query Language)は、データベース管理システムにおいてデータの操作や取得を行うための言語です。以下の要素がSQLの特徴です:

  • データの挿入:新しいデータをデータベースに追加します。
  • データの取得:特定の条件に基づいてデータを抽出します。
  • データの更新:既存のデータを変更します。
  • データの削除:不要なデータを削除します。
  • SQLは、さまざまなデータベースシステムで広く使用されており、その標準化により、異なるデータベース間でも互換性があります。

    複数とは

    「複数」とは、データベース内で複数のレコードや情報を指します。複数のデータを扱う上で重要な点は以下の通りです:

  • データの一貫性:複数のデータが整合性を保つことが必要です。
  • 効率的なクエリ:複数のデータを同時に扱うクエリが求められます。
  • 集約関数:複数のレコードから要約や集計を行います。
  • 結合(JOIN):異なるテーブルからデータを連携させる手法です。
  • SQL In 複数の利用例

    SQLを使用することで、複数のデータを効率的に操作できます。SQLはデータ操作の基本機能を提供し、特に大量のデータを扱う際に強力です。以下に具体的な利用例を示します。

    データベースの操作

    データベースを操作する際、以下のような機能があります。

  • 挿入: 新しいレコードをデータベースに追加します。例えば、ユーザー情報や製品データなど。
  • 更新: 既存のレコードのデータを修正します。これにより、例えばユーザーのメールアドレスを変更できます。
  • 削除: 不要なレコードを削除します。例えば、退会したユーザーのデータを削除することがあります。
  • 選択: 特定の条件に基づいてデータを取得します。必要な情報だけを抽出できます。
  • これらの操作により、私たちはデータの整合性を保ちながら効率的に管理できます。

    クエリの実行

    クエリを実行する際のポイントは、正確な構文を使用することです。一般的なクエリの種類には以下が含まれます。

  • 単純クエリ: 一つのテーブルからデータを取得します。
  • 結合クエリ: 複数のテーブルを結合してデータを取得します。これにより、関連する情報を一度に見ることができます。
  • 集約関数: グループごとの集計を行います。例えば、売上データを月ごとに集計することが可能です。
  • サブクエリ: 他のクエリの結果を使ってさらに絞り込みます。
  • その他の項目:  ダブルワークと雇用保険の関係と必要な知識

    SQL In 複数の利点

    SQLを使用することで、私たちは複数のデータを簡潔に扱うことができ、様々な利点が得られます。ここでは、特に「効率的なデータ管理」と「複雑な分析」について詳しく見ていきます。

    効率的なデータ管理

    データ管理の効率化は、複数のレコード処理において極めて重要です。私たちは、以下の方法でデータの整合性を保ちながら操作を行うことができます。

  • バルクインサート:一次的に大量のデータを一括で挿入することで、処理時間を短縮できます。
  • トランザクション管理:複数の操作を一つの単位として管理し、データの整合性を守ります。
  • インデックスの活用:検索速度を向上させ、大量データからの迅速な情報取得を実現します。
  • 集約関数の使用:データの集計を簡単にし、分析に必要な情報を迅速に提供します。
  • これらの手法により、私たちはデータ管理の効率を大幅に向上させることができます。

    複雑な分析

    複雑な分析においてSQLは不可欠なツールです。特に、大量のデータセットを扱う場合、SQLの強力な機能が役立ちます。具体的には、以下の点が挙げられます。

  • 結合(JOIN)の使用:複数のテーブルから情報を統合し、関連性を浮き彫りにします。
  • サブクエリの活用:他のクエリの結果を元に、さらに絞り込んだ分析が可能となります。
  • ウィンドウ関数の利用:データをパーティション化して、特定の条件下での分析を行います。
  • 条件付き集計:指定した条件に基づいてデータを集約することで、詳細な洞察を得ます。
  • SQL In 複数の注意点

    SQLを使用する際の重要な注意点の一つに、エラー処理があります。エラーはデータベース操作において避けられないもので、正確なエラー処理が求められます。次のようなポイントを意識します。

    • トランザクションの利用: 操作が失敗した場合、一連の操作を元に戻すことでデータの整合性を保てる。
    • 詳細なエラーメッセージの取得: データベースが返すエラーメッセージを活用し、問題を迅速に特定できる。
    • リトライロジックの実装: 一時的な障害が発生した場合に備え、再試行のロジックを組み込む。
    • ログの記録: エラー発生時の詳細を記録し、後で分析に役立てる。

    次に、パフォーマンスの最適化について考えます。複数のデータを扱う際、パフォーマンスの確保が重要になります。以下に、効果的な最適化手法を示します。

    • インデックスの利用: データ検索の効率を向上させるため、適切なカラムにインデックスを設定する。
    • クエリの最適化: 不要なデータを除外し、効率的なクエリ文を使用して処理速度を向上させる。
    • 結合の最適化: 不要な結合を避けることで、クエリの複雑さを軽減し、パフォーマンスを向上させる。
    • データの正規化: 冗長性を減らし、データベースの設計を見直すことで、効率的なデータ管理を実現する。

    Conclusion

    SQLを活用することで複数のデータを効率的に管理し分析する力が身につきます。私たちが学んだテクニックや手法を駆使することでデータの整合性を保ちながら迅速な操作が可能になります。特に、結合や集約関数の活用はデータの洞察を深めるために欠かせません。

    エラー処理やパフォーマンスの最適化を意識することで、よりスムーズなデータ操作が実現します。これらの知識を基に、私たちのデータベース操作スキルをさらに向上させていきましょう。SQLの力を最大限に引き出し、データを駆使したビジネスの成功に繋げていくことができるはずです。

    コメントする